## Deployment

FeedProbe validates podcast RSS feeds for the Castwright platform. Single stateless binary; runs behind the Quorline edge proxy. No inbound ports beyond 8443. Outbound fetches are restricted to an allowlist enforced at the proxy, not in-process — review that separately. Secrets arrive via the Vaultern agent at boot; nothing is written to disk. Rotate the fetch token quarterly. Logs go to Driftsink with URLs redacted. The service reads the following configuration at startup, shown here for audit purposes.

deployment values, fafog-fawip:
[jorox]
team = fendor
access_code = ac_bb00ea
host = jorox.qorveltech.internal
port = 9200
owner = istdor.aldeth
peer = julvan.orvexlabs.internal

**Step 7 — Partner SFTP drop key.** Applies to plugin authors shipping builds to the Quellbridge partner drop. During the ceremony, the Fernwick ops lead rotates the drop's host key and regenerates the escrow bundle. Plugin authors: do not cache the old fingerprint; your next upload must verify against the new one published in the ceremony minutes. Confirm your plugin manifest references escrow slot B before signing off. If the drop is ever locked out mid-rotation, recovery requires the passphrase recorded below.

unlock words, hahip-baduf: holwyn-istath-julvan

// WEEKLY SYNC NOTE — replica lag alarm threshold (Quillbase cluster)
// Heads up: we bumped this from 30s to 45s after the Fenwick
// migration kept tripping pages for lag that self-healed in under
// a minute. Nobody loves a noisier constant, but the on-call
// churn was worse. Revisit once the new replicas land.
// The verification run that justified the bump is below.

build token for haduf-bafog: htk21_2d98ce91a83676b65394a

**Q: Where do contractors get on the Wi-Fi at Bramfold House?**

Easy one — head to the guest Wi-Fi desk just left of reception on the ground floor. The team there will sort you out with a day pass; no need to book ahead. Just note the desk sits behind the turnstiles, so you'll need the visitor gate code to reach it.

staff pass of kawip-hawef = bdg-QLP-2